"Portrait of a Gentleman on Horseback" is a painting by renowned artist Peter Tillemans, noted for his distinctive artistic style and masterful composition. Originally 104 x 130 cm in size, this masterpiece captivates viewers with its elegance and detail.

Tillemans' artistic style is characterized by his precise and realistic approach. In this painting, we can appreciate how he masterfully captures the details of the horse, the rider, and the surrounding landscape. Each brush stroke is carefully applied, creating a sense of texture and movement in the image.

The composition of the painting is another highlight. Tillemans skillfully manages to balance the main elements of the work: the rider and his horse in the foreground, and the landscape in the background. The rider is in a position of power and dominance, while the horse displays an elegant posture and alert gaze. The background landscape, with its softly outlined trees and hills, adds depth and atmosphere to the scene.

As for colour, Tillemans uses a soft and harmonious palette. Earth tones dominate the painting, giving it a warm, natural look. Colors are skillfully mixed, creating a feeling of light and shadow in the image. The artist also uses more vibrant colors in details such as the rider's clothing, to highlight his prominent position.

The history of this painting is fascinating. It was created in the 18th century, during a time when equestrian portraits were very popular among the aristocracy. These works of art were considered symbols of status and power, and were commissioned by nobles to show their social position. "Portrait of a Gentleman on Horseback" is a notable example of this artistic genre, as it captures the elegance and grace of the upper class of the time.

Despite its beauty and recognition, there are little-known aspects of this painting. For example, the horseman portrayed in the work is believed to be an important historical figure, although his exact identity remains a mystery. Furthermore, some scholars suggest that Tillemans may have been inspired by the tradition of hunting painting to create this work, adding an additional element of interest to the piece.
